[twitter]用户名称对换

This commit is contained in:
DELL 2026-01-21 17:53:48 +08:00
parent 8631b0febf
commit 7b3a83a1ab

View File

@ -143,13 +143,13 @@ class TwitterSpider(scrapy.Spider):
item['is_newest'] = 1
item['platform_type'] = "Twitter"
item['user_id'] = instructions['rest_id']
item['username'] = instructions['core']['name']
item['nickname'] = instructions['core']['screen_name']
item['nickname'] = instructions['core']['name']
item['username'] = instructions['core']['screen_name']
item['user_url'] = f'https://x.com/{uname}'
item['avatar_url'] = instructions['avatar']['image_url']
item['image_urls'] = [instructions['avatar']['image_url']]
item['intro'] = instructions['legacy']['description']
item['city'] = 'ceshi' # instructions.get('legacy', {}).get('location', {}).get('location', '').strip()
item['city'] = instructions.get('legacy', {}).get('location', {}).get('location', '').strip()
try:
# 转换为 datetime 对象
ts = get_time_stamp(